Anton Kimig will take notice that Elijah Burn er has filed a petition in the District Court of the County of Xeinaha, in the Territory of Nebraska, in Chancery sitting, to which the said .Acton Kimig is mtde party defendant. The object and prayer of said petition is to foreclose a mortgage made by said Kimig, June I7th, 1859, in favor of said Burner, on the South E.st quarter of Section 10, in Township 6 North, of Uange 14 East of the 8th principal meridian, situated in said County of Nemaha, which mortgage was made to secure the payment of a promissory note of even date there with, made by said Kimig in favor of said Burner, for two hundred and sixty-five dollars with inter est at forty percent per annum from maturity, due one year from dat e thereof. The petition asks for a decree for the sale of said premises to satisfy said note and that the defendant be debarred and foreclosed of all right to the same. Delendant is required to answer on or before the 2d day of April, 1S56. Dated February, ISth 1856. . BIENZI STRETER, Register, By Wm.IL Hoover, Deputy.
